Graphic designer Miura showcases the tools of the trade for ten occupations, including tailor, watchmaker, and chef. First, a double-page spread displays the tools (with labels), and readers can guess who uses them. The next spread identifies the occupation and shows someone on the job. The varying typefaces, simple shapes, and thoughtful composition make for a handsome volume.
